Just a point of general info, if anyone is interested in bidding:
There's a 25% "Buyer's Premium" added onto your bid by the auction house. I'm not sure, but this seems to be customary practice. I found out about this when I bid (successfully) on a lovely 20s A-4 a couple of years ago. I hadn't read the fine print until it was all over and it was mine. Come to find out my final expenditure, with that, plus shipping and insurance, was not so much of a good deal as I'd thought, and I might have done well to have passed. Still below the typical going rate, just not by quite as much.
Many of you may well know that. This being my first time bidding on an online auction house item (rather than eBay, etc), it was a surprise.
